3) Far from elliding the importance of addressing imperialism, the last chapter of "The Political Theory of Liberal Socialism" chastises earlier liberal socialists for NOT paying nearly enough attention to it. It even calls that a "failure" that contributed to liberal socialisms marginalization.

2) My arguement about the realization of human capacities might be wrong, but it is certainly not anti-Marxist. Marx posits the importance of realizing human capacities/powers/energy at several points (one of the things he DOES take up from Aristotle), including late in Capital VOl III.
